Le Havre Docks A partial exploration
revealed 60009/032/036
There is now a new stabling
and servicing facility in the docks consisting of a single road inspection shed
plus fuelling and sanding facilities. It is located at the Rouen end
of Faisceau Alluvionnaire at the junction of Route Industielle and Route de la
Plaine. I have put a maplink here :
http://maps.google.co.uk/maps?ll=49.477246,0.25719546&z=17&t=h&hl=en-GB
If you are on foot don’t
attempt to walk it - a taxi is required!
New Stabling Point 22255/273/282/304 27125/162/167 60044/054

The book “Brits Abroad” now
needs updating as 08738 and 08939 [ both marked EWS International ] were found
at Vallourec & Mannesman Tube factory. 64016 was in exchange
sidings. The rail lines don’t appear on all maps so I have put a map link
here:-
http://maps.google.co.uk/maps?ll=49.466363,1.0466372&z=17&t=h&hl=en-GB

Note :- Colas-Rail
locos 27 ( CCM AT 1LL 810 ) and 40 ( CCM AT 1LL 809 ) can be found at Anor Gare
where they run over the line to Mommignies Quarry. SecoRail Vosslohs are also
found here.
